开启Redis集群新篇章启动Redis节点(启动redis节点)

2023-05-13 07:07:25 节点 启动 新篇章

随着大数据技术和服务的普及,在云端的操作中,Redis的性能体验越来越重要,为了满足不同场景的需求,有时需要将普通的Redis实例更换为集群模式,从而提供强大灵活的数据存储和处理能力。

我们来了解一下如何搭建Redis集群。Redis集群模式使用Redis原生的分布式集群解决方案。通常情况下,在一台服务器上至少要安装3个Redis实例,启动它们时,可以指定不同的端口号,例如0号、1号、2号。之后,使用以下命令启动Redis集群:

redis-trib.rb create –replicas 8 ip:port ip:port ip:port…

其中,–replicase表示设置副本的数量,是单个实例自动复制到多个服务端的数量;后面是对应的每个节点的ip:port号,多个节点用空格分隔。可以使用以下命令检查状态:

redis-trib.rb check ip:port

如果检查结果是“cluster state isok”,则表示已经建立好集群。此外,也可以使用以下命令管理Redis集群:

Move:将某个key的hashslots从当前节点移动到另一个节点;

Add-node:将一个服务器上的普通Redis实例添加到集群中;

Delnode:从集群中删除某个节点;

Check-migrate:检查key迁移进度;

Rebuild:重新构建集群。

有了上面的搭建和管理方法,就可以开始部署Redis集群服务啦。下面介绍一下Redis集群部署后如何启动Redis节点。要确保节点间没有外部连接限制,即集群每个节点都可以通过其他节点的ip:port访问;确保节点的配置信息正确,通常情况下,共享相同的配置文件,并且配置文件内指定正确的监听ip:port和name;再次,启动集群每个节点,命令如下:

redis-server path/to/redis.conf

再次使用以下命令检查集群状态:

redis-trib.rb check ip:port

如果检查结果是“cluster state isok”,则表示Redis节点启动成功,部署的Redis集群也已经构建完成,就可以使用Redis集群来服务了。

以上就是Redis集群部署并启动Redis节点的过程,通过这样的技术,基int云端操作的呈现出强大的灵活性和可靠性,现在我们为Redis集群开启了一个新篇章,尽情玩耍吧!

相关文章